GOGAMA – An officer with the Gogama Detachment of the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) has charged a 68-year-old Val Caron, Ontario man as a result of a traffic stop on Highway 144 on October 5, 2014.

While conducting traffic patrol of Highway 144 in the Gogama area, an OPP officer observed a vehicle being driven at speeds of 50 kms over the posted limit.

As a result of the traffic stop and police investigation, the driver, Andre Emile GIROUX, was charged with race a motor vehicle section 172. (1), as per the Highway Traffic Act. 

In addition his driver’s licence was suspended for seven days and his vehicle was impounded for seven days.

He is scheduled to attend the Ontario Court of Justice in Gogama on November 24, 2014.
